Anniversaries
Anniversary gifts work particularly well with engraved wine boxes because the occasion is already rooted in dates and shared memories. For a first anniversary, a box engraved with the wedding date and a simple message can feel wonderfully sentimental. For bigger milestones like a 25th or 40th anniversary, a slightly more formal engraved design often suits the occasion better.
This is one of the times when it helps to think about the couple's style. Some will love a romantic message. Others will prefer something clean and understated with just names and the anniversary year. Neither is better - it depends on whether they are the sort of couple who display keepsakes or prefer a more subtle finish.
Birthdays
Birthday gifting gives you more room to have fun. Milestone birthdays such as 18th, 21st, 30th, 40th, 50th and 60th are perfect for personalised wine boxes because the age can become part of the design. That instantly makes the gift feel made for them.
For a parent, partner or grandparent, adding a short line alongside the name and age can make all the difference. It does not need to be long. In fact, shorter often looks more elegant on wood. A few well-chosen words tend to feel warmer than trying to fit in a whole message.

What to engrave on a wine box
This is often the point where shoppers overthink. The best engraving is usually clear, relevant and easy to read. Names, dates and short occasion-led phrases tend to work best because they age well and suit the keepsake nature of the box.
If you are buying for a wedding or anniversary, names and the date are usually enough. For birthdays, adding the age often gives the design more character. For retirements and thank-yous, a brief message can work well if it stays concise.
There is a balance to strike. Too little engraving can feel generic, but too much can make the design look crowded. If the box is part of a polished gift presentation, a simple layout often feels more premium than trying to include every sentiment you have.
Picking the right bottle to go inside
An engraved box can hold its own as a keepsake, but the bottle still matters. The safest choice is not always the most expensive one. It is the bottle that suits the recipient.
For a couple, a bottle they can share usually makes the most sense. For a parent or grandparent, you might choose something they already enjoy rather than experimenting. If you are unsure whether they drink red or white, sparkling wine can be a strong middle ground for celebratory occasions.
If the recipient is not a wine drinker, this format may still work depending on the box style. Some shoppers use engraved wooden boxes for other bottled gifts, but it is worth checking the size and purpose first. A personalised gift should feel thoughtful, not forced into the wrong occasion.
